Databricks’ Position in the Big Data Analytics Market

Databricks dominates the market for unified analytics platforms, offering a robust ecosystem for data engineers and data scientists. Its core strength is the integration of data engineering and data science tools within a single platform, streamlining the entire data lifecycle. This unified approach streamlines workflows, allowing for faster data processing and analysis.

Key Features and Functionalities Differentiating Databricks

Databricks distinguishes itself through its unified platform, comprehensive ecosystem, and powerful features. Key differentiators include:

  • Unified Platform: Databricks’ platform combines data engineering tools with data science capabilities, creating a seamless workflow. This integration simplifies the entire data lifecycle, from data ingestion and transformation to model training and deployment.
  • Scalability and Performance: Built on Apache Spark, Databricks excels at handling massive datasets and complex computations. Its scalable architecture allows for efficient processing and analysis of large volumes of data.
  • Machine Learning Capabilities: Databricks’ platform supports the entire machine learning lifecycle, from model development and training to deployment and monitoring. This comprehensive approach allows users to leverage machine learning effectively within their data pipelines.

Major Competitors and Their Strengths and Weaknesses

Several companies compete with Databricks in the big data analytics space. Notable competitors include Amazon EMR, Google Cloud Dataproc, and Snowflake.

  • Amazon EMR (Elastic MapReduce): Amazon’s EMR provides a robust platform for big data processing. Its strength lies in its integration with the broader Amazon Web Services (AWS) ecosystem. However, its integration of data engineering and data science tools may be less seamless compared to Databricks.
  • Google Cloud Dataproc: Google Cloud’s Dataproc is a powerful platform based on Apache Spark. Its strengths include strong integration with other Google Cloud services and a focus on simplifying data workflows. However, it might lack the comprehensive machine learning features present in Databricks’ platform.
  • Snowflake: Snowflake is a cloud-based data warehousing solution, focusing primarily on data storage and querying. Its strength is in its ability to handle large volumes of data and perform complex queries. However, its integration with data engineering tools and machine learning workflows may not be as comprehensive as Databricks’.
